Categories DavidIsland weeping willow Post author By David Post date 7 December 2013 Weeping willow on one of the islands in the West Park lake, and, to its left, trees on the far shore, reflected in the gently wavy water. ← Earth star in leaf litter, Castlecroft → Pizza on a stick